Question Number: 31323Law 12 - Fouls and Misconduct 3/8/2017RE: REC SELECT Under 15 Gary of nashua, NH USA asks...https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=qU1OWTUcsVs Please asses the validity of the 2 pks given...fouls or no? Answer provided by Referee Richard Dawson Hi Gary if they were give as PKs then the referee considered it a foul! If you are asking should they have been given as a an opinion based on video review the 1st one was a reasonable PK the 2nd one not so much! Cheers

View Referee Richard Dawson profileAnswer provided by Referee Joe McHugh Hi Gary My view on these is that the first one is certainly a foul and a penalty whereas the second one is not a foul. In the first one the defender has his arms around the attacker and it looks like a pull to the ground. On the second one the defender plays the ball albeit awkwardly and then there is a coming together. That awakard play of the ball by the defender would have looked very suspect in real time so I could see why a penalty was awarded.
